GREAT FALLS, Mont., January 2, 2015 — The Helena Bighorns and Great Falls Americans renewed their NA3HL rivalry on Friday night in Great Falls. In their last meeting on November 23rd in Helena, Great Falls came away with a 3-1 win.rnrnDespite a loss in Billings on Wednesday night, the Americans returned home to the Great Falls Ice Plex where they are currently 14-3 on home ice (25-4 overall) and remain in first place in the NA3HL’s Frontier Division. Meanwhile, the Bighorns from Helena, who had a four-game winning streak, are 19-7-1 and they sit in third place behind Gillette and Great Falls. rn

BILLINGS, Mont., December 31, 2014 — The Great Falls Americans looked to close out 2014 on a high note as they faced the Billings Bulls in the Magic City on New Year’s Eve.rnrnAfter a week off for the holiday break, the Americans resumed competition in the NA3HL on Wednesday night. Great Falls has won two of their three meetings this season including a 3-0 shutout victory on November 14th.rn

Americans goaltender Hauser called up to NAHL’s Kenai River Brown Bears

GREAT FALLS, Mont., December 29, 2014 — The Great Falls Americans Junior A Hockey team are pleased to announce that goaltender Evan Hauser has been called up to the Kenai River Brown Bears in Soldotna, Alaska of the North American Hockey League (NAHL), according to American Head Coach and General Manager, Jeff Heimel.
